A Bold Move into the Streaming Era

When Days of Our Lives officially made the leap from NBC to Peacock in September 2022, it was more than just a programming decision—it was a landmark moment that signaled the end of a television tradition that had endured for nearly six decades. For generations of viewers who had grown up watching the iconic soap unfold during NBC’s daytime block, the move felt deeply personal, almost like saying goodbye to a familiar, comforting ritual. It marked the close of an era in broadcast television, one where soap operas once dominated the midday airwaves, and ushered in a new phase where even the most time-honored franchises must adapt to the ever-evolving digital landscape.

NBC’s decision to transition Days off its linear network and replace it with NBC News Daily was framed as a strategic move—one aimed at capturing the attention of a changing audience. As younger viewers increasingly migrate toward on-demand content and streaming platforms, the network sought to realign its daytime offerings to reflect those shifting habits. While the logic made sense in the context of modern media consumption, the emotional impact on longtime fans was undeniable. Many questioned whether such a deeply serialized, relationship-driven show could thrive in a space dominated by binge-worthy thrillers and quick-turn reality content.

However, those doubts were quickly dispelled. Rather than fading into obscurity, Days of Our Lives flourished in its new home. The series not only retained its loyal fanbase—it expanded it. Within months of the transition, Days emerged as one of Peacock’s top-performing titles, regularly landing in the platform’s Top 15 most-watched entertainment programs. Streaming Success, But Nostalgia Remains

In December 2024, the show celebrated a monumental milestone—its 15,000th episode—a feat few scripted series have ever achieved. In 2025, it garnered 13 Daytime Emmy nominations, the highest number since its move to streaming, reaffirming its artistic merit and cultural significance. From dramatic cliffhangers to heartfelt reunions, Days continues to offer the kind of storytelling that resonates deeply with its devoted audience.

But even amid these achievements, nostalgia lingers. Some fans, particularly those less accustomed to streaming services, have continued to express a desire to see the show return to broadcast TV. This sentiment gained momentum when a viral social media post suggested that Days of Our Lives might return to NBC sometime in 2025. The claim has not been confirmed by NBC or Peacock, but its wide circulation reflects a broader yearning among the fanbase—a longing for the comforting familiarity of watching the series at its longtime 1 p.m. slot on daytime television.

What’s Fact, What’s Fantasy?

While the rumor has sparked hope and debate, it’s essential to separate fact from speculation. At this stage, there is no official confirmation from NBCUniversal that Days of Our Lives will be returning to NBC’s broadcast schedule. However, the series’ sustained popularity, both in terms of viewership and critical acclaim, ensures that it remains a valuable asset. Whether or not it rejoins the daytime lineup on network TV, its renewal for two more seasons signals a bright future—albeit one firmly rooted in the streaming realm, at least for now.

Adding further intrigue is the show’s recent commitment to its legacy cast. Suzanne Rogers, who has portrayed Maggie Horton Kiriakis for over five decades, was the subject of online exit rumors earlier this year. However, the production quickly dismissed the speculation, affirming that Rogers remains an integral part of the show. Her presence offers a sense of continuity and tradition—elements that are particularly meaningful as the series balances innovation with legacy.

At the same time, Days is not immune to change. Actor Billy Flynn, who has portrayed Chad DiMera for the past 10 years, has confirmed his departure from the series. While his exit marks the end of a significant era for one of Salem’s most prominent characters, the door remains open for a possible return in the future, as is often the case in the world of daytime drama.
